Located just moments away from West Kensington tube station, Maurizio Barca is a charming Italian restaurant which serves a vast menu of pizzas, pastas and more.
Spread out over two floors and with the additional benefit of a small garden out the back, it’s also the ideal spot to host a private dinner. Whether you want to host a small group of friends for a birthday, or a larger meal for your business, Maurizio Barca has you covered with its variety of different spaces which can be exclusively hired.
The main restaurant space on the ground floor is wonderfully bright and airy, and features plants hanging down from the walls. For large groups, this is the perfect space to hire for a private dinner as there is room for one large table which everyone can sit round. Alternatively, there is the passageway space upstairs which is better suited to more intimate dinners, particularly if you want people sat down at long tables. The passageway also has direct access to the garden meaning that you and your guests can easily enjoy the fresh air before and after your meal.
When it comes to the menu at Maurizio Barca, there are plenty of choices to choose from. Starters vary from a classic Italian focaccia served with parma ham, to seafood dishes such as baby octopus, and spicy prawns served with cherry tomatoes. Larger plates include an array of pasta dishes ranging from gnocchi with tomato sauce, all the way through to monkfish paccheri; as well as a selection of sourdough pizzas. If you’re feeling like something a little meatier, dishes such as pork shank and meatballs also feature on the menu.
The appealing food offering is accompanied by an equally tempting list of wines, cocktails and beers, while there’s the option to finish your private dinner with a traditional shot of limoncello or grappa.
